
The Chamber of Deputies will vote on the newest version of the Covid restrictions next week, which will last until the week following the Easter holidays.
However, these are unlikely to be the last set of restrictions before a complete reopening. For this reason, the government has opted to extend leave for family reasons until the summer term ends on 17 July.
The special dispensations in place for parental leave were due to expire on 3 April.
Parents are eligible for leave if their child is placed in isolation or quarantine, or if their child's school or creche has been closed due to an outbreak.
The bill, with LSAP MP Georges Engel as rapporteur, will be put to a vote next week.
